South Park, Pennsylvania (PA): Economy and Business Data & Market Research
accommodation & food services, waste management, arts, etc.


Based on the data from 1997 when the population of South Park, Pennsylvania was 14,058

Number of Establishments per 100,000 population

  • A) Wholesale trade: 1997 - 11 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 78, State average - 17)
  • B) Retail trade: 1997 - 24 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 170, State average - 62)
  • C) Real estate & rental & leasing: 1997 - 5 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 35, State average - 12)
  • D) Professional, scientific & technical services: 1997 - 15 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 106, State average - 36)
  • E) Administrative & support & waste management & remediation service: 1997 - 10 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 71, State average - 14)
  • F) Educational services: 1997 - 2 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 14, State average - 3)
  • G) Health care & social assistance: 1997 - 13 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 92, State average - 47)
  • H) Arts, entertainment & recreation: 1997 - 1 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 7, State average - 5)
  • I) Accommodation & food services: 1997 - 17 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 120, State average - 34)
  • J) Other services (except public administration): 1997 - 14 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 99, State average - 35)
